Main Page | Class Hierarchy | Class List | Directories | File List | Class Members | Related Pages

StaffItem Class Reference

Inheritance diagram for StaffItem:

Inheritance graph
[legend]
Collaboration diagram for StaffItem:

Collaboration graph
[legend]
List of all members.

Public Types

enum  Columns {
  COL_FIRST_NAME = 0, COL_LAST_NAME, COL_DEPT, COL_FACULTY,
  COL_INSTITUTE
}

Public Member Functions

 StaffItem (Staff *StaffObj, RootItem *parent=0, int cc=0)
 StaffItem (StaffItem &si)
virtual StaffgetItemData () const
InstitutegetInstitute ()
FacultygetFaculty ()
DepartmentgetDept ()
StaffgetStaff ()
QString getInstName () const
QString getFacName () const
QString getDeptName () const
QString getDescription () const
QString getStaffFName () const
QString getStaffLName () const
QVariant data (int column) const
bool setStaffFName (QString name)
bool setStaffLName (QString abbrev)
bool setData (int column, const QVariant &value)
void dbSave ()
void dbDelete ()

Detailed Description

Definition at line 27 of file StaffItem.h.


The documentation for this class was generated from the following files:
Generated on Thu Apr 6 16:27:21 2006 for time-table by  doxygen 1.4.4